you try default to factory..
you can try to firmware upgrade to latest version... of degrade to previous one..

sometimes when you play a lot with configuration, something saves wrong in config files...

if this will not help, probably you have mechanical / electrical problem...

ps. try other streams (main/sub/third).. try different apps (DMSS / SmartPSS)...
